Can you leave a dog in a hotel room by itself?
Most hotels don’t want animals to be in there unattended. Some will allow it if they’re crated but if yours are yappy, you might very well get asked to leave as soon as you return from eating. I would recommend a pet friendly AirBNB as an alterative or taking them out with you as I did with mine. Do dogs realize how long you’re gone?
While your dog may remember you leaving the house, they cannot gauge the lengths of time you’ve been gone. This absence can trigger stress, often linked to separation anxiety, suggesting some level of time awareness. Dogs, though, don’t grasp the abstract concept of time as humans do. What is a hotel for dogs called?
On the other paw, a dog boarding hotel, also known as a “pet hotel” or “hotel for dogs,” offers a more comprehensive and luxurious boarding experience. Unlike traditional kennels, dog hotels prioritize the comfort and well-being of their furry guests, aiming to replicate a home-like environment.
